Tankers come in two basic forms, pure tanks that do all the things you picture in the war movies, and what they call the "armored cavalry," which is used more like traditional horse cavalry from back in the day. As a result, they have a certain sprit de corps, and the officers even wear old timey cavalry hats on special occasions.
They have a saying - "If you ain't Cav, you ain't." I think they mean "ain't shit," but they have short attention spans and need to truncate their sentences.
